Patents Assigned to Synerkine Pharma B.V.
  • Patent number: 12365713
    Abstract: The invention is concerned with a fusion protein comprising interleukin 13 and a regulatory cytokine, for example, an interleukin chosen from interleukin 4, interleukin 10, interleukin 27, interleukin 33, transforming growth factor beta 1, transforming growth factor beta 2, and interleukin 13, a nucleic acid molecule encoding such fusion protein, a vector comprising such nucleic acid molecule, and a host cell comprising such nucleic acid molecule or such vector. The invention further pertains to a method for producing such fusion protein. The fusion protein or a gene therapy vector encoding the fusion protein may be used in the prevention or treatment of a condition characterized by pathological pain, chronic pain, neuro-inflammation and/or or neurodegeneration.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: March 14, 2022
    Date of Patent: July 22, 2025
    Assignee: Synerkine Pharma B.V.
    Inventors: Niels Eijkelkamp, Cornelis Erik Hack, Judith Prado Sanchez, Jelena Popov-Čeleketić, Sabine Versteeg

  • Patent number: 10851143
    Abstract: The invention is concerned with a fusion protein comprising interleukin 10 and interleukin 4, a nucleic acid molecule encoding such fusion protein, a vector comprising such nucleic acid molecule, and a host cell comprising such nucleic acid molecule or such vector. The invention further pertains to a method for producing such fusion protein. The fusion protein or a gene therapy vector encoding the fusion protein may be used in the prevention or treatment of osteoarthritis, chronic pain, a condition characterized by local or systemic inflammation, immune activation, and/or lymphoproliferation.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: December 14, 2017
    Date of Patent: December 1, 2020
    Assignee: Synerkine Pharma B.V.
    Inventors: Joel Adrianus Gijsbert Van Roon, Sarita Aimee Yvonne Hartgring, Cornelis Erik Hack, Christina Louws, Floris Paulus Jacobus Gerardus Lafeber
